Continuity notes
- This episode happens concurrently with the previous two and the following one. Knock Out returns from his mission in "Tunnel Vision", which was a failure, and Dreadwing has already returned after losing the Apex Armor to Starscream in "Triangulation". On the Autobot side of things, Bulkhead returns from his mission, which takes place in the following episode, diving through the GroundBridge with severe damage to his back.
Transformers references
- Soundwave's drone is finally referred to as Laserbeak in the show, despite the toy having named the drone earlier.
